Accuracy and Reliability

Choosing a continuous glucose monitor (CGM) requires careful consideration of its accuracy and reliability, fundamental factors that play a pivotal role in effective diabetes management.

Accuracy

  • Measured by mean absolute relative difference (MARD), lower percentages indicate better accuracy than traditional blood glucose meters.
  • Real-time glucose readings help you understand fluctuations, enabling timely adjustments.

Reliability

  • Affected by sensor placement, calibration, and adherence to guidelines.
  • Users may need occasional fingerstick tests to confirm readings during rapid glucose changes.
  • Sensor lifespan ranges from 7 to 14 days, but issues may arise before the intended lifespan.

These factors are vital for selecting a CGM that meets your needs and guarantees consistent, reliable monitoring.

Comfort and Wearability

When considering a continuous glucose monitor (CGM), comfort and wearability are essential factors that can greatly impact your experience.

  • Design: Look for thin, flexible biosensors designed for prolonged wear.
  • Insertion: Many CGMs offer painless applicators to reduce anxiety associated with needle insertion.
  • Adhesive Quality: Make sure the adhesive provides reliable hold while allowing skin breathability to prevent irritation.
  • Weight and Profile: Opt for lightweight, compact devices to enhance comfort during daily activities.
  • Water Resistance: Choose models with water-resistant features, allowing you to swim and shower without removing the device.

Evaluating these aspects can help guarantee a seamless experience as you monitor your glucose levels effectively.

Price and Affordability

Understanding the price and affordability of continuous glucose monitors (CGMs) is as important as their maintenance and technology features.

  • Price Variability: CGMs vary widely in cost, influenced by technology, features, and brand reputation.
  • Initial and Ongoing Costs: Expect initial expenses for the device, plus recurring costs for replacement sensors or test strips.
  • Subscription Models: Some devices require subscription fees for advanced app functionalities, impacting your overall budget.
  • Insurance Coverage: Coverage differs greatly; while some plans may cover costs fully, others might impose co-pays or exclude specific brands.

When evaluating CGM options, thoroughly compare both upfront and long-term expenses to make an informed, financially sound choice.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Do Continuous Glucose Monitors Differ From Traditional Blood Glucose Meters?

Continuous glucose monitors (CGMs) and traditional blood glucose meters serve the same purpose but differ greatly in functionality:

  • Measurement Method: CGMs track glucose levels continuously via interstitial fluid, while traditional meters require a single blood drop for each reading.
  • Data Frequency: CGMs provide real-time data, displaying trends and variations, whereas traditional meters offer snapshots of glucose at specific moments.
  • User Experience: CGMs reduce the need for frequent fingersticks, increasing comfort and convenience for users.

Can Continuous Glucose Monitors Be Used for Non-Diabetic Individuals?

Yes, continuous glucose monitors (CGMs) can be used by non-diabetic individuals.

  • Health Monitoring: They provide real-time glucose data, enabling individuals to track their metabolic responses to different foods and activities.
  • Fitness Applications: Many athletes use CGMs to optimize performance through precise nutritional planning.
  • Data Analysis: Non-diabetic users can gather valuable insights, helping them adjust diets or lifestyle choices based on glucose trends.

This usage extends CGM benefits beyond diabetes management.

Are Continuous Glucose Monitors Covered by Insurance?

Are continuous glucose monitors (CGMs) covered by insurance?

  • Many private insurers and Medicare often cover CGMs, particularly for individuals with diabetes.
  • Coverage varies by policy, so you should check specifics with your provider.
  • Typically, doctors must provide medical necessity documentation.
  • Out-of-pocket costs may apply, depending on your plan.
